What You Will Be DoingAs the Administrative Assistant 3, you will serve as the primary administrative support position for the Alaska International Airport System (AIAS), playing a critical role in supporting the daily business operations of one of the nation's premier aviation systems. In this position, you will:
- Coordinate procurement activities, authorize payments and expenditures, resolve vendor discrepancies, and help ensure AIAS receives the best value while maintaining compliance with State policies.
- Support AIAS financial operations by monitoring expenditures and revenues, assisting with budget reporting and adjustments, and managing travel, invoicing, procurement card administration, and reconciliation processes.
- Provide administrative support to the AIAS Director and Administrative Operations Manager while working collaboratively with Finance, Budget, Information Technology, Planning and Development, Air Service Development, Communications, and other administrative teams.
- Serve as the backup Recruitment Coordinator, assisting with recruitment, hiring, and onboarding activities that support a growing and evolving organization.
- Contribute to the success of the Alaska International Airport System by helping ensure the administrative and financial functions that support both Ted Stevens Anchorage International Airport and Fairbanks International Airport operate efficiently and effectively.
